SEND Teaching Assistant | Wigan | Start ASAP

Are you passionate about making a difference in the lives of children with special educational needs and disabilities (SEND)? Do you have the patience, empathy, and dedication to support pupils in achieving their full potential?
We are currently seeking a committed and nurturing SEND Teaching Assistant to join a welcoming and inclusive secondary school in Wigan. This is a fantastic opportunity to work closely with pupils who require additional support, helping them to access the curriculum and thrive in a supportive learning environment.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Provide 1:1 and small group support to pupils with SEND, including autism, ADHD, and speech & language needs.
  • Assist the class teacher in implementing tailored learning strategies.
  • Promote positive behaviour and emotional well-being.
  • Support pupils with personal care (if required).
  • Help create a safe, engaging, and inclusive classroom environment.
Requirements:
  • Previous experience working with children with SEND (school-based or other relevant settings).
  • A calm, patient, and resilient approach.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• A genuine passion for supporting children with additional needs.
  • Enhanced DBS on the update service (or willing to apply for one).
